Kevin Hetrick – Contending for a Knoxville Championship!

A rookie in the 305 class hopes to aim for a championship this season at the Knoxville Raceway. Kevin Hetrick was the 2010 34 Raceway champion, and he has targeted the same honor at the famous half-mile this season. The Gladstone, Illinois driver will be campaigning the family #35. […]

OCEAN SPRINTS RETURN TO ACTION FOR FRIDAY’S OPENER IN WATSONVILLE

The highly anticipated return of the Ocean Sprints presented by Taco Bravo fires off Friday night from John Prentice’s Ocean Speedway Watsonville, with some of the best 360 Sprint Car talent in the nation squaring off. After a hotly contested 2012 campaign won by Fremont’s Shane Golobic, the 2013 edition looks to be wide-open. […]
